    PVC flange 1" to high
    I have a 3" PVC inside pipe flange with tile and concrete up to outside pipe. Is there a way of fixing this problem without cutting flange and tile and concrete or shimming toilet with large gap?
  • Apr 15, 2012, 06:33 AM
    speedball1
    Several options come to mind.
    1. Cut the PVC pipe and flange of flush with the floor.and Prime and glue in a 3" outside flange, **OR**
    2. You could platform the bowl and connect that way. What's your pleasure? Good luck, Tomn
